admin 2025-05-09 23:16:23 加拿大女足世界杯

新安装idea有哪些地方需要设置

新安装idea有哪些地方需要设置

发布时间:2021-06-25 09:45:34

来源:亿速云

阅读:177

作者:chen

栏目:大数据

# 新安装IDEA有哪些地方需要设置

## 前言

作为一款强大的Java集成开发环境(IDE),IntelliJ IDEA在安装完成后需要进行一系列优化配置才能充分发挥其效能。本文将详细介绍新安装IDEA后的关键设置项,涵盖界面优化、性能调优、插件管理等方面,帮助开发者打造高效舒适的开发环境。

---

## 一、基础环境配置

### 1. 主题与外观设置

- **切换主题**:`File → Settings → Appearance & Behavior → Appearance`

- 推荐深色主题(如Darcula)减少视觉疲劳

- 调整字体大小(建议14-16px)

- 开启`Sync with OS`实现系统主题同步

- **编辑器字体**:`Editor → Font`

- 推荐等宽字体:JetBrains Mono/Fira Code/Cascadia Code

- 建议大小:14-16px,行间距1.2-1.5

### 2. 编码与文件模板

```settings

File → Settings → Editor → File Encodings

全局编码设置为UTF-8

勾选Transparent native-to-ascii conversion

配置默认文件模板(如添加作者信息、版权声明)

二、核心功能优化

1. 智能提示增强

Editor → General → Code Completion

开启Match case智能匹配大小写

调整自动弹出延迟(建议200-300ms)

启用Show suggestions as you type

2. 代码风格配置

Editor → Code Style

设置缩进(Java建议4空格)

配置自动换行和行长限制(推荐120字符)

导入团队代码风格配置文件(如google-style.xml)

3. 版本控制集成

Version Control → Git

配置Git可执行文件路径

开启Auto-update功能

设置提交代码时的代码分析选项

三、性能调优设置

1. 内存分配

Help → Change Memory Settings

根据机器配置调整:

8G内存:建议1024-2048MB

16G内存:建议2048-4096MB

2. 索引优化

File → Settings → Appearance & Behavior → System Settings

添加需要排除的目录(如node_modules)

关闭不必要的文件类型索引

3. 启动配置

Help → Edit Custom VM Options

添加参数(示例):

-Xms1024m

-Xmx2048m

-XX:ReservedCodeCacheSize=512m

四、插件管理策略

1. 必备插件推荐

插件名称

功能描述

Key Promoter X

快捷键提示

Rainbow Brackets

彩色括号匹配

SonarLint

代码质量检测

Grep Console

控制台日志增强

2. 插件安装方式

官方仓库安装:Settings → Plugins → Marketplace

离线安装:下载zip包后Install Plugin from Disk

3. 插件维护建议

定期检查插件更新

禁用不常用插件提升性能

备份插件配置(File → Export Settings)

五、工作流定制

1. 快捷键配置

Keymap →

推荐方案:

Windows/Linux:默认方案

macOS:Mac OS X 10.5+

自定义高频操作快捷键(如代码格式化)

2. 实时模板配置

Editor → Live Templates

添加常用代码片段(如psvm生成main方法)

创建自定义模板组(如公司内部规范)

3. 运行/调试配置

配置默认JVM参数

设置默认测试运行器(JUnit/TestNG)

保存常用运行配置为模板

六、其他实用设置

1. 多模块项目管理

配置SDK版本一致性

设置模块依赖关系

统一编译器输出路径

2. 数据库工具配置

连接本地/远程数据库

设置SQL方言和格式化规则

配置数据源驱动

3. 终端集成

Tools → Terminal

修改默认Shell(推荐使用PowerShell/zsh)

调整缓冲区大小(建议10000行)

结语

合理的IDEA配置可以显著提升开发效率。建议根据个人开发习惯和项目需求进行个性化调整,并定期备份配置(File → Export Settings)。随着IDEA版本更新,部分设置路径可能发生变化,可通过Help → Find Action快速定位设置项。

提示:使用Shift+Ctrl+A快捷键可快速搜索所有设置项

“`

(注:本文实际约1100字,Markdown格式便于直接用于文档编写)